Renault aims to use 2017 MGU-K from Russian GP
Renault is hoping to get its 2017 MGU-K back on its cars from the Russian Grand Prix, after having to revert to last year's specification for the start of the Formula 1 season. Reliability concerns about the new MGU-K prompted the French car manufacturer to adopt a no-risk strategy at the first races for its work team, plus Red Bull and Toro Rosso. But the move back to the 2016 version has not come without penalty, because the older specification is 5kg heavier and requires an extra 1kg air bottle for cooling.
